Login
Start Free Trial Are you a business? Click Here

Imren 25R 18650 2500mAh - 2 Pack Reviews

4.5 Rating 28 Reviews
For the price you can't go wrong. Great batteries.
Helpful Report
Posted 4 years ago
Never shipped wait 3 weeks. I just cancel the order
Helpful Report
Posted 4 years ago
Good as ever.. Thanks
Helpful Report
Posted 4 years ago
Wonderful
Helpful Report
Posted 4 years ago